Understanding Poison Ivy Rashes and Their Symptoms

Poison ivy rashes are caused by an allergic reaction to the oil found in the sap of the poison ivy plant. This oil, known as urushiol, can cause severe itching, redness, and blistering on the skin. The symptoms of a poison ivy rash can range from mild to severe and typically include redness, itching, and swelling of the affected area. In some cases, the rash can become infected, leading to more serious complications.

The severity of the symptoms can vary depending on the individual’s sensitivity to the urushiol oil and the amount of exposure. Some people may experience only mild symptoms, while others may have a more severe reaction. It’s essential to recognize the symptoms of a poison ivy rash and seek treatment promptly to prevent further complications.

Poison ivy rashes can be treated with a variety of creams and ointments, including those containing calamine, hydrocortisone, and antihistamines. These creams can help to reduce itching, inflammation, and redness, and can also help to prevent infection. In addition to using creams and ointments, there are several home remedies that can help to alleviate the symptoms of a poison ivy rash, such as applying cool compresses, taking oatmeal baths, and using topical creams containing capsaicin.

It’s also important to take steps to prevent exposure to poison ivy in the first place. This can include wearing protective clothing, such as long sleeves and pants, when spending time outdoors, and avoiding areas where poison ivy is known to grow. By taking these precautions and being aware of the symptoms of a poison ivy rash, individuals can reduce their risk of exposure and minimize the severity of their symptoms if they do come into contact with the plant.

Types of Poison Ivy Creams and Their Ingredients

There are several types of poison ivy creams available, each with its own unique ingredients and benefits. Calamine cream is a popular option, as it can help to reduce itching and inflammation, and can also dry out oozing blisters. Hydrocortisone cream is another option, as it can help to reduce redness and swelling, and can also be used to treat other skin conditions, such as eczema and acne.

Antihistamine creams are also available, which can help to relieve itching and reduce the allergic response. These creams typically contain ingredients such as diphenhydramine or chlorpheniramine, which can help to block the release of histamine, a chemical that contributes to the allergic response. Some poison ivy creams also contain natural ingredients, such as aloe vera, tea tree oil, and oatmeal, which can help to soothe and calm the skin.

In addition to these ingredients, some poison ivy creams may also contain other additives, such as fragrances, dyes, and preservatives. It’s essential to read the label carefully and choose a cream that is fragrance-free and hypoallergenic, especially if you have sensitive skin. By selecting a cream that is right for your skin type and needs, you can help to alleviate the symptoms of a poison ivy rash and promote healing.

Preventing Poison Ivy Rashes and Reducing the Risk of Exposure

Preventing poison ivy rashes is always better than treating them, and there are several steps you can take to reduce the risk of exposure. One of the most effective ways to prevent poison ivy rashes is to avoid areas where the plant is known to grow. This can include wooded areas, parks, and other outdoor spaces where the plant is common. If you must spend time in these areas, wear protective clothing, such as long sleeves and pants, and apply a barrier cream to any exposed skin.

It’s also essential to recognize the appearance of poison ivy and avoid touching the plant. Poison ivy has characteristic leaves with three pointed lobes, and it can grow as a vine or a shrub. If you come into contact with the plant, wash your skin immediately with soap and water to remove any urushiol oil. This can help to reduce the severity of the rash and prevent it from spreading.

Can I use poison ivy cream on broken skin?

It’s generally not recommended to use poison ivy cream on broken skin, as this can exacerbate the condition and lead to further complications. Broken skin can be more susceptible to infection, and applying a cream to an open wound can push bacteria and other contaminants deeper into the skin. Additionally, some ingredients in poison ivy creams, such as hydrocortisone, can delay the healing process of broken skin.

If you have broken skin due to scratching or other factors, it’s essential to prioritize wound care and healing before using a poison ivy cream. Gently clean the affected area with mild soap and water, and apply an antibiotic ointment to prevent infection. Once the wound has started to heal, you can consider using a poison ivy cream to manage the remaining symptoms. However, always consult a doctor before using any cream on broken skin, as they can provide personalized guidance and recommend the best course of treatment.

What are the common side effects of poison ivy creams?

The common side effects of poison ivy creams can vary depending on the ingredients and individual skin types. Some people may experience mild side effects, such as redness, itching, or burning, especially when using a cream for the first time. Other potential side effects include dryness, irritation, or allergic reactions, especially if you have sensitive skin. In rare cases, poison ivy creams can cause more severe side effects, such as skin thinning or discoloration, especially with prolonged use.

To minimize the risk of side effects, always follow the instructions on the label and apply the cream as directed. Start with a small patch test to ensure you don’t have any sensitivity or allergic reactions to the ingredients. If you experience any side effects, discontinue use and consult a doctor for alternative treatments. Additionally, be aware that some ingredients in poison ivy creams, such as hydrocortisone, can have long-term effects with prolonged use, such as skin thinning or adrenal suppression. Always prioritize a doctor’s advice and follow their recommendations for using poison ivy creams safely and effectively.
